Research Experience
  • Joined the Soft Transducers Lab (LMTS) at EPFL, Switzerland, in 2014 to work on haptic displays based on miniaturized electromagnetic actuators. In 2018, moved to the AIT Lab to continue working in haptics and wearables.
Education
  • M.Sc. and Ph.D. in Physics from Instituto Balseiro, Bariloche, Argentina. During his doctoral project, he worked on microfabricated infrared sensors at the BT-CAB Laboratory.
Background
  • Research Interests: Tactile interaction, design and fabrication of haptic systems. Professional Field: Computer Science. Brief Introduction: Working at the Advanced Interactive Technologies lab (AIT) at ETH Zurich, focusing on how we interact through the sense of touch and improving systems that receive our tactile information and provide feedback.
